Parenteral nutrition should not be used routinely in patients with an … SpletTotal parenteral nutrition (TPN) can cause a variety of liver diseases, including hepatic steatosis, gallbladder and bile duct damage, and cholestasis. Cholestasis is the most severe complication and can lead to progressive fibrosis and cirrhosis. It is the major factor limiting effective long-term use of TPN in children and adults.

Splet29. jan. 2016 · A protein-restricted diet has historically been recommended to patients with chronic liver disease to prevent hepatic encephalopathy by avoiding an increase in serum ammonia. Studies have not supported this hypothesis, and protein restriction may actually worsen malnutrition in patients with cirrhosis. Splet01. feb. 2008 · TPN-IC is a liver complication that is evidenced by a rise in serum-conjugated bilirubin of 2 mg/dL or more, which may be accompanied by increases in γ-glutamyl transpeptidase, alkaline phosphatase, and serum transaminase. This complication should be suspected in all the patients treated with hospital and home parenteral nutrition.
